AndAstronautics,Nanjing 21ool6,China) Abstract : C++ and UG Open grip language are used to develop the automatic design software of the whole process micro一evaporation tube combustor from one一dimensional design to parametric modeling,and therapid design and reconstructionof the micro combustor are realized.The method is appied toa micro一combustor,thecombustion chamberconfigurations with differentopeningmodesaredesigned,andtheschemeof performancestandardisoptimized by numerical simulation.
